Summary
Chisholm Trail Middle in Round Rock, TX, serves 718 students in grades 6-8 and is part of the highly-rated Round Rock Independent School District (Isd), which ranks in the top 21% of Texas districts. This school has a solid, consistent track record, earning a 4-star rating from SchoolDigger for the past decade, though its performance tells a fascinating story of contrasts.
The school's most striking feature is its exceptional performance in advanced mathematics, with Algebra I End-of-Course exam proficiency rates consistently above 97%—far exceeding the district average of around 60-70%. This suggests a highly effective program for identifying and accelerating students into advanced math. However, this success creates a "Jekyll and Hyde" math profile: while advanced math soars, grade-level math performance is a significant concern, particularly in 7th grade, where only about 13% of students are proficient, the lowest among comparable Round Rock ISD middle schools. In contrast, the school excels at supporting its Special Education students, who consistently rank in the top 15-20% of the state—a notable strength. Yet, the school struggles to serve its Hispanic and low socio-economic status students, who rank in the bottom half of the state, indicating a persistent achievement gap.
Geographically, Chisholm Trail is sandwiched between two very different schools: Cedar Valley Middle (2 miles away), a 5-star, top-3% school that outperforms in nearly every subject, and C D Fulkes Middle (1.35 miles away), a 1-star school that struggles significantly. Interestingly, Chisholm Trail spends more per student ($10,040) and has a lower student-teacher ratio (14.2) than higher-performing peers like Cedar Valley, suggesting its challenges are not about resources but about refining instructional strategies for specific student groups. Overall, Chisholm Trail is a stable, solid school with standout strengths in advanced math and special education, but it has room to grow in closing achievement gaps and improving grade-level math performance.
